Compare all specifications:

1995 Alpina B 12 1972 Steyr Haflinger
Make Alpina Steyr
Model B 12 Haflinger
Year Released 1995 1972
Engine Size 3500 cc 643 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 2 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 0 HP 27 HP
Torque 469 Nm 45 Nm
Drive Type Rear 4WD
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 1790 kg 654 kg
Vehicle Length 4790 mm 2860 mm
Vehicle Width 1860 mm 1410 mm
Vehicle Height 1350 mm 1750 mm
Wheelbase Size 2690 mm 1510 mm
